Mule 3010 Trans4x4T Diesel
Kawasaki introduces the all-new Mule 3010 Trans4x4T Diesel model to the line-up. This off-road dynamo features a transformable design, fully automatic transmission with two- or four-wheel drive options, and takes just a few minutes to convert from a two-person to a four-person ride.
While the cargo payload expands from 400 to 800 pounds in the two-person configuration, users have the ability to select between cargo and personnel carrying needs, depending on the specific job at hand. This versatility, coupled with Kawasaki's liquid-cooled, three-cylinder diesel make the Mule 3010 Trans4x4 Diesel an immediate winner.
The Mule 3010 Trans4x4 is also available in a gas version, which offers the same off-road handling and transformable four-passenger or two-passenger capabilities. Mule 610 4x4
Looking for a compact utility vehicle with extra pulling power? Then the Mule 610 4x4 is the one for you. It's the first off-road utility vehicle in the compact class to feature selectable four-wheel drive. Powered by a 401cc engine, the Mule 610 4x4 works hard and looks good!
